Moststudentsarriveatcollegeusing“discrete,concreteandabsolutecategoriestounderstandpeople,knowledge,andvalues.”Thesestudentslivewithadualisticview,seeing“theworldinpolartermsofwe-right-goodvs.other-wrong-bad.”Thesestudentscannotacknowledgetheexistenceofmorethanonepointofviewtowardanyissue.Thereisone“right”way.Andbecausetheseabsolutesareassumedbyorimposedontheindividualfromexternalauthority,theycannotbepersonallysubstantiatedorauthenticatedbyexperience.Thesestudentsareslavestothegeneralizationsoftheirauthorities.Aneyeforaneye!Capitalpunishmentisaptjusticeformurder.TheBiblesaysso.

Moststudentsbreakthroughthedualisticstagetoanotherequallyfrustratingstage—multiplicity.Withinthisstage,studentsseeavarietyofwaystodealwithanygiventopicorproblem.However,whilethesestudentsacceptmultiplepointsofview,theyareunabletoevaluateorjustifythem.Tohaveanopinioniseveryone’sright.Whilestudentsinthedualisticstageareunabletoproduceevidencetosupportwhattheyconsidertobeself-evidentabsolutes,studentsinthemultiplisticstageareunabletoconnectinstancesintocoherentgeneralizations.Everyassertion,everypoint,isvalid.Intheirdemocracytheyaredirectionless.Capitalpunishment?Whatsenseisthereinansweringonemurderwithanother?

Thethirdstageofdevelopmentfindsstudentslivinginaworldofrelativism.Knowledgeisrelative:rightandwrongdependonthecontext.Nolongerrecognizingthevalidityofeachindividualideaoraction,relativistsexamineeverythingtofinditsplaceinanoverallframework.Whilethemultiplistviewstheworldasunconnected,almostrandom,therelativistseeksalwaystoplacephenomenaintocoherentlargerpatterns.Studentsinthisstageviewtheworldanalytically.Theyappreciateauthorityforitsexpertise,usingittodefendtheirowngeneralizations.Inaddition,theyacceptorrejectostensibleauthorityaftersystematicallyevaluatingitsvalidity.Inthisstage,however,studentsresistdecisionmaking.Sufferingtheambivalenceoffindingseveralconsistentandacceptablealternatives,theyarealmostoverwhelmedbydiversityandneedmeansformanagingit.Capitalpunishmentisappropriatejustice—insomeinstances.

Inthefinalstagestudentsmanagediversitythroughindividualcommitment.Studentsdonotdenyrelativism.Rathertheyassertanidentitybyformingcommitmentsandassumingresponsibilityforthem.Theygatherpersonalexperienceintoacoherentframework,abstractprinciplestoguidetheiractions,andusetheseprinciplestodisciplineandgoverntheirthoughtsandactions.Theindividualhaschosentojoinaparticularcommunityandagreestolivebyitstenets.Theaccusedhashadthebenefitofdueprocesstoguardhiscivilrights,ajuryofpeershasfoundhimguilty,andthestatehastherighttoendhislife.ThisisaprinciplemycommunityandIendorse.

Itisallverywelltoblametrafficjams,thecostofpetrolandthequickpaceofmodernlife,butmannersontheroadsarebecominghorrible.Everybodyknowsthatthenicestmenbecomemonstersbehindthewheel.Itisallverywell,again,tohaveatigerinthetank,buttohaveoneinthedriver’sseatisanothermatteraltogether.Youmighttoleratetheoddroad-hog,therudeandinconsiderate,butnowadaysthewell-manneredmotorististheexceptiontotherule.Perhapsthesituationcallsfor“BeKindtoOtherDrivers’Campaign,”otherwiseitmaygetcompletelyoutofhand.

Roadpolitenessisnotonlygoodmanners,butgoodsensetoo.Ittakesthemostcool-headedandgood-temperedofdriverstoresistthetemptationtorevengewhensubjectedtouncivilizedbehavior.Ontheotherhand,alittlepolitenessgoesalongwaytowardsrelievingthetensionsofmotoring.Afriendlynodorawaveofacknowledgmentinresponsetoanactofpolitenesshelpstocreateanatmosphereofgoodwillandtolerancesonecessaryinmodemtrafficconditions.Butsuchacknowledgmentsofpolitenessarealltooraretoday.Manydriversnowadaysdon’tevenseemabletorecognizepolitenesswhentheyseeit.

However,misplacedpolitenesscanalsobedangerous.Typicalexamplesarethedriverwhobrakesviolentlytoallowacartoemergefromasidestreetatsomehazardtofollowingtraffic,whenafewsecondslatertheroadwouldbeclearanyway;orthemanwhowavesachildacrossazebracrossingintothepathofoncomingvehiclesthatmaybeunabletostopintime.Thesamegoesforencouragingoldladiestocrosstheroadwhereverandwhenevertheycareto.Italwaysamazesmethatthehighwaysarenotcoveredwiththedeadbodiesofthesegrannies.

Aveterandriver,whosemannersarefaultless,toldmeitwouldhelpifmotoristslearnttofiltercorrectlyintotrafficstreamsoneatatimewithoutcausingthetotalblockagesthatgiverisetobadtemper.Unfortunately,modemmotoristscan’tevenlearntodrive,letalonemasterthesubtleraspectsofroadsmanship.Yearsagotheexpertswarnedusthatthe“car-ownershipexplosion”woulddemandalotmoregive-and-takefromallroadusers.Itishightimeforallofustotakethismessagetoheart.
